> *** EEPROM MAC address is invalid.

This means that EEPROM reading returned zeros, which probably happens=20
because either:
- the EEPROM really contains bad data; very unlikely, but given that
there are 2 reports with very similar hardware, it might be possible
- the EEPROM is not powered correctly - this is most likely related to=20
some power management (ACPI) changes in the respective kernels. It has=20
nothing to do with the driver per-se; maybe the driver needs to call=20
some power management routine before reading the EEPROM. I think that=20
I've seen in the past months some mention of a patch for 3c59x that=20
said something about power management, but I can't remember clearly...
